About This Item
London:: Hodder & Stoughton,, n.d. [circa 1910-12].. First trade edition.. publisher's gilt rust-colored pebbled cloth.. Bookplate on pastedown; 1910 ink gift inscription opposite the half-title page. A very few spots of scattered foxing; contents otherwise fine. Tiny areas of rubbing to the corner tips and extremities of the spine; tight, unworn and sound. . Folio,. With 30 tipped-in color plates by Edmund Dulac..
